The fountain on Velké náměstí in the town of Králíky

In the middle of the Great Square in the center of the town of Králíky, the fountain of 1851 is worth noting. It is decorated with a statue of Přadlena, standing on a six-sided pillar with water spouts in the form of dolphins, which reminds of the rich weaving tradition of the town of Králíky. There are benches placed around it, on which you can relax in the shade of the trees surrounding the fountain. There is also a nice view of the entire Great Rectangular Square.
